How much does it cost to rent an apartment in San Gabriel?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
San Gabriel Studio Apartments | $990 | $649 | $1,929 |
San Gabriel 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,192 | $729 | $1,929 |
San Gabriel 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,396 | $850 | $2,279 |
San Gabriel 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,746 | $1,050 | $3,064 |
San Gabriel 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|

Getting Around the San Gabriel Neighborhood in Tucson, AZ
Walk Score®
57 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
91 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
42 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om San Gabriel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in San Gabriel with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in San Gabriel is at Villas Las Mandarinas listed at $729.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om San Gabriel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in San Gabriel is $1,192.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om San Gabriel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in San Gabriel is a 950 square feet unit starting from $1,500 at 2001-2009 E 7th street.
What is the average size for San Gabriel 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in San Gabriel is currently 675 sq ft.
